Our Lord tells a parable in which the owner of vineyard has a righteous and reasonable expectation of fruit from the tree he has planted; arrives at righteous frustration with the absence of fruit; shows wonderful consideration, willing to invest yet more in the hope of the tree producing, but eventually ready to cut it down if it bears no fruit, that it might not draw away that which would be a blessing to others. We consider the application to the people to whom Christ first spoke, and to churches and individuals today.
